Krynoid bursts as Scorby escapes

The alien Krynoid erupts through the lab’s main entrance with violent speed, forcing Stevenson into immediate combat. As chaos engulfs the room, the Doctor spots Scorby’s plane lifting off, a cruel irony underscoring the fractured team’s powerlessness. The Krynoid’s rampage exposes the fragility of human control amid winter isolation, while Scorby’s escape confirms betrayal and abandons the survivors to the spreading extraterrestrial threat. The Doctor remains an acute observer, his quick eyes noting both the Krynoid’s violent incursion and Scorby’s plane taking flight. Unlike Stevenson, he registers no panic—only focused assessment of threats, his intellect racing to recognize the new danger of abandonment while calculating countermeasures to the immediate crisis.

The Krynoid erupts through the lab entrance with terrifying speed, its plant-based body bursting through metal and ice as if they were fragile paper. It immediately focuses on Stevenson, its assault a symphony of snapping vines and rending force, converting panic into immediate physical domination within seconds.

Stevenson stands within the cramped lab, his voiced plea to the main base cut short as the Krynoid erupts through the entrance with brutal suddenness, hurling him backward before he can finish transmitting. His frantic struggle against the grasping vegetation quickly becomes a fight for breath, his earlier authoritative urgency reduced to raw survival.

Though physically absent, Scorby’s escape via plane is confirmed by the Doctor’s sighting, cementing his role as a betrayer prioritizing personal survival over team cohesion. His earlier operational detachment now curdles into outright abandonment, leaving allies to face the spreading Krynoid threat entirely alone.
